CASE STUDY Mandiswa ’ s Journey to Property Entrepreneurship
Location : iKwezi Park , Khayelitsha , Cape Town Challenge : Financial stability and planning for retirement Mandiswa , a dedicated mother and wife , acquired her property in 1998 . Working at a local mall near her home , she began thinking about her family ’ s future and retirement plans .

As her children had all become adults , Mandiswa was determined to create a stable financial future for them , one that would not depend on her physical presence or employment .

Frustrations Mandiswa wanted to build backyard flats to generate rental income for her retirement and to set up her family for the future . However , she lacked the financial resources and technical expertise to embark on such a project . Without the capital to fund construction and the knowledge to navigate the legal and technical requirements of property development , her dream felt far out of reach .
Solution In 2022 , Mandiswa partnered with Bitprop , embarking on a transformative 10-year journey to turn her property into a long-term income-generating asset . Under the terms of the partnership , she would receive 15 % of the gross rental income from the newly developed units . The additional income would help cover everyday expenses , such as groceries and municipal bills .
What ’ s more , after 10 years , the entire rental income would be hers , enabling her to run the property as a sustainable business . This not only promised a steady income stream for her family but also the flexibility and financial independence to manage her time as an entrepreneur .
